Technical Definition
The register Battery2 Max temp at address 5 is used to monitor battery2 max temp on the Batt Monitoring.
- Protocol: Modbus RTU
- Data Type: S WORD
- Unit: °C
- Access: Read Only

💡 Engineer's Insight
Analysis: Battery 2 maximum Temperature, measured in degrees Celsius (°C). Monitors the highest Temperature experienced by any cell or sensor.
Troubleshooting: Excessively high temperatures indicate thermal runaway risk or cooling system failure. A zero reading might be a sensor failure or if the battery is not operational.
